Thanks guys !! These headlights are at least 75% more light on the road compared to stock E99 lights. They came with bulbs in them but they weren't as bright as Sylvania SilverStars that I had in the E99 lights. Well after driving it last night I had to readjust the headlights. As I tried to get them dialed in I found that the optic reflector in the Right headlight was alittle different than the left. Most people would never notice but I am a freak when it comes to details. It just defuses the light a little different. But considering that some 9 yr old in Tiawan made them I can't be that upset and they were 30% of the cost of OEM.
Kinda falls under you get what you paid for. So if you are super picky and have deep pockets buy OEM.
Over all I am very pleased with the look and how they are putting on the road is good, not great but maybe the relay & bulbs Jason was talking about will get me there.
